Abstract

In this work two new coordination polymers (CPs) with formulas [Zn2(Cl)(BTC)(bmb)2] (1) and [Cd2(H2O)2(BTC)2·H2bmb·6H2O] (2) (bmb=1,4-bis(2-methylimidazol-1-yl)butane and H3BTC ​= ​1,3,5-benzenetricarboxylic acid), have been prepared and characterized by various spectroscopic data. The single crystal X-ray data suggests that 1 comprises a 2D layered network and 2 has a 3D porous framework with pcu-type topology. The photocatalytic properties revealed that 2 could successfully degrade organic dyes such as Rhodamine B (Rh B), methylene orange (MO), and methylene blue (MB). Further, the trapping experiment established the active species in the photodegradation process.
